Alex Zinenko
984c2c8cb3 [mlir] verify against nullptr payload in transform dialect
When establishing the correspondence between transform values and
payload operations or parameters, check that the latter are non-null and
report errors. This was previously allowed for exotic cases of partially
successfull transformations with "apply each" trait, but was dangerous.
The "apply each" implementation was reworked to remove the need for this
functionality, so this can now be hardned to avoid null pointer
dereferences.

Alex Zinenko
4b455a71b7 [mlir] adapt TransformEachOpTrait to parameter values
Adapt the implementation of TransformEachOpTrait to the existence of
parameter values recently introduced into the transform dialect. In
particular, allow `applyToOne` hooks to return a list containing a mix
of `Operation *` that will be associated with handles and `Attribute`
that will be associated with parameter values by the trait
implementation of the transform interface's `apply` method.

Disentangle the "transposition" of the list of per-payload op partial
results to decrease its overall complexity and detemplatize the code
that doesn't really need templates. This removes the poorly documented
special handling for single-result ops with TransformEachOpTrait that
could have assigned null pointer values to handles.

Alex Zinenko
ed02fa81fd [mlir] introduce parameters into the transofrm dialect
Introduce a new kind of values into the transform dialect -- parameter
values. These values have a type implementing the new
`TransformParamTypeInterface` and are associated with lists of
attributes rather than lists of payload operations. This mechanism
allows one to wrap numeric calculations, typically heuristics, into
transform operations separate from those at actually applying the
transformation. For example, tile size computation can be now separated
from tiling itself, and not hardcoded in the transform dialect. This
further improves the separation of concerns between transform choice and
implementation.

Jeff Niu
c48e0cf03a [mlir] Remove TypedAttr and ElementsAttr from DenseArrayAttr
This patch removes the implementation of TypedAttr and ElementsAttr
from DenseArrayAttr and, in doing so, removes the need store a shaped
type. The attribute now stores a size (number of elements), an MLIR type
as a discriminator, and a raw byte array.

The intent of DenseArrayAttr was not to be a drop-in replacement for DenseElementsAttr. It was meant to be a simple container of integers or floats that map to C++ types. The ElementsAttr implementation on DenseArrayAttr had many holes in it, and fixing those holes would require evolving DenseArrayAttr in a way that is incompatible with its original purpose.

Matthias Springer
c1fef4e88a [mlir][bufferization] Make TensorCopyInsertionPass a test pass
TensorCopyInsertion should not have been exposed as a pass. This was a flaw in the original design. It is a preparation step for bufferization and certain transforms (that would otherwise be legal) are illegal between TensorCopyInsertion and actual rewrite to MemRef ops. Therefore, even if broken down as two separate steps internally, they should be exposed as a single pass.

This change affects the sparse compiler, which uses `TensorCopyInsertionPass`. A new `SparsificationAndBufferizationPass` is added to replace all passes in the sparse tensor pipeline from `TensorCopyInsertionPass` until the actual bufferization (rewrite to memref/non-tensor). It is generally unsafe to run arbitrary passes in-between, in particular passes that hoist tensor ops out of loops or change SSA use-def chains along tensor ops.
